An internet sex sting nabs a PIAA official. State Attorney General Tom Corbett made the anouncement today. 55-year-old Leonard Stossel of Altoona was arrested after undercover agents, posing as children on the internet, were allegedly contacted by Stossel. "The unit has continued to operate and is now focused on going after the predators trying to steal the innocence of our young... this year alone over 26 arrests of individuals trying to lure chidren into sexual relationships with adults." Corbett says more arrests are expected in this operation.
